A UK agency brings market fluency you can’t replicate quickly: British English tone, local buyer behaviour, and channel norms across England, Scotland, Wales, and Northern Ireland. They understand UK compliance (GDPR and PECR for email/SMS), ASA advertising guidance, and procurement processes common in the UK public sector and enterprise spaces.

Moreover, you’ll also tap into deep sector clusters: London for fintech and professional services, Cambridge–Oxford for deep tech and life sciences, the Midlands for manufacturing, and Edinburgh–Glasgow for financial services and gaming. That context helps teams create persona-led content, ABM plays, and lead nurturing sequences that resonate with UK decision-makers, while operating on a convenient time zone for EMEA growth.

Pricing varies because of a number of factors, including scope, seniority, and tooling. Based on Clutch’s recently acquired data, most UK-based inbound marketing firms charge:

  • Monthly retainers: £3,000 – £15,000, covering strategy, SEO, content, email, and reporting
  • Project engagements (e.g., content sprints, HubSpot onboarding): £8,000 – £50,000
  • Hourly rates: £70 – £150

Costs trend higher for regulated industries, multi-language EMEA campaigns, or complex RevOps/CRM integration. To compare value, ask agencies to tie pricing to pipeline KPIs and to show effort allocation across strategy vs. production vs. promotion.

UK-based inbound marketing agencies support a vast spectrum of markets and niches, often with deep domain expertise in:

  • Financial services and fintech — thought leadership, compliance-reviewed content, ABM for enterprise buyers
  • SaaS and deep tech — product marketing, sales enablement, lifecycle email
  • E-commerce and retail — SEO, CRO, full-funnel content, CRM-driven campaigns
  • Life sciences, health, and biotech — medically reviewed content and gated assets for lead gen
  • Media, gaming, and entertainment — community, influencer, and content distribution
  • Manufacturing and engineering — technical content, distributor enablement, and international SEO
  • Education and nonprofit — mission-led narratives, grants/public-sector procurement experience
